Transaction 2135810f7224805caf7c86ae1192615a8da8ba6aee0da298d5435817a34aa423

1 Input
2 Outputs
  • 2135810f7224805caf7c86ae1192615a8da8ba6aee0da298d5435817a34aa423:0
  • value  4949989988
    address  mik4YdxB5vPnuJTSwCr2DeGfoQBS7zmpTP
  • 2135810f7224805caf7c86ae1192615a8da8ba6aee0da298d5435817a34aa423:1
  • value  50000000
    address  n2Pnk24otnGt5Q54CiT3HitP8sxTMVfeZM